Vertical Laminar Airflow Cabinet ADVL-513 features exterior dimensions of 990×700×1650 mm for easy lab integration. Constructed with a centrifugal fan and an electrostatically coated steel shell for long-lasting durability. The wind speed is adjustable in six levels within the range of 0.3 to 0.6 m/s with real-time display. Large LCD display provides real-time status updates, enhancing user monitoring. It is widely used in research and laboratories to ensure the production of sterile drugs and medical devices.

1. How does a Vertical Laminar Airflow Cabinet contribute to aseptic processing?
A Vertical Laminar Airflow Cabinet provides ISO Class 5 clean air that flows uniformly downward across the work surface. This unidirectional flow helps to remove contaminants from the air and prevents cross-contamination during aseptic processing, making the Vertical Laminar Airflow Cabinet ideal for sterile techniques.
2. Should the sash of a Vertical Laminar Airflow Cabinet be closed during operation?
Unlike biosafety cabinets, most Vertical Laminar Airflow Cabinets have an open front or a removable sash. The sash should remain in its designed position during use to maintain proper airflow and closing it during operation may interfere with the cabinet’s laminar flow efficiency.
3. Is vibration a concern when using a Vertical Laminar Airflow Cabinet?
Excessive vibration can interfere with delicate work inside a Vertical Laminar Airflow Cabinet, such as weighing or pipetting. It's best to use vibration-dampening materials or position sensitive equipment on stable surfaces within the Vertical Laminar Airflow Cabinet to avoid disturbance.
4. How long does a HEPA filter last in a Vertical Laminar Airflow Cabinet?
The HEPA filter in a Vertical Laminar Airflow Cabinet typically lasts 1 to 3 years, depending on usage and environmental conditions. Regular monitoring and annual testing will determine if the filter in your Vertical Laminar Airflow Cabinet needs to be replaced sooner.
5. Can a Vertical Laminar Airflow Cabinet be customized for specific applications?
Yes, a Vertical Laminar Airflow Cabinet can be customized with features like UV lights, stainless steel side panels, or adjustable stands. Some manufacturers also offer optional accessories to suit tasks like PCR setup, electronics assembly, or plant micropropagation.
6. Are Vertical Laminar Airflow Cabinets noisy during operation?
A Vertical Laminar Airflow Cabinet produces low to moderate noise, generally around 55–65 dB, which is comparable to normal conversation. Newer models are designed to minimize fan and motor noise while maintaining strong, consistent airflow.
